Originally Posted by Shanajustin
Me hugging....and I kid you not.....one of seven of the worlds most valuable 426 Hemi engines ever made. The #'s matching engine from 1 of 7 1971 hemi CONVERTIBLE 'cudas that are still surviving. 1 of 11 ever made.

That my friend will go across the auction block at Barrett-Jackson sometime in the future. The former owner (a friend's stepdad) sold the car in pieces to a collector in Nebraska for a large sum of money. It should sell for over $1.2 million, double the collector's initial investment.
